Simencourt is a commune in the Pas-de-Calais department in the Nord-Pas-de-Calais region of France.

Contents

Geography [edit]

Simencourt lies 7 miles (11.3 km) southwest of Arras, at the junction of the D7 and D67 roads.

Places of interest [edit]

  • An eighteenth-century manor house.
  • The church of St.Médard, dating from the sixteenth century.
  • Scene of fighting in 1918 by 9th Battalion (North Irish Horse) Royal Irish Fusiliers.
